
At Equine Match, we’re pushing the boundaries of what’s possible in pedigree analysis with our latest product development — the 9-Generation Pedigree Knowledge Graph. Unlike traditional pedigree charts, which are limited to just 5 generations on a single page, knowledge graphs mimic the way that the human brain naturally makes connections, offering a more intuitive approach to spotting patterns within pedigrees that might not otherwise be as obvious traditionally.
Powered by two decades of data sourced from acquisitions and partnerships with trusted providers like Arion Pedigrees, the knowledge graph is created by processing the data through advanced graph theory techniques.
The 9-pedigree generation knowledge graph can be filtered by generation – allowing users to view any generation in isolation, or any combination of generations such as generations 3 and 5, or all 9 generations at once, enabling cross-generation pattern identification. Users can also use this tool to spot what may be missing within a pedigree, allowing them to genetically enhance the pedigree.
In the future, users will be able to query the knowledge graphs with our machine learning algorithms, asking questions like “What are the commonalities between multiple pedigree graphs?” or “For a given stallion where are the deficiencies in a pedigree and which stallions would best balance the deficit in key ancestors?”. These insights will help breeders and buyers make more informed choices backed by data-driven analysis.
